Role Overview:

Join Altium as a Site Reliability Engineer to ensure the reliability and performance of the Altium Cloud Platforms.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Understanding how an Altium Cloud Platform works
  • Pioneer improvements in observability, including logging, monitoring, and application performance management (APM), ensuring system reliability and proactive issue detection.
  • Contribute to incident response and management, ensuring rapid resolution, clear stakeholder communication, and post-incident analysis for continuous improvement.
  • Participate in infrastructure upgrades, patching, and maintenance activities.
  • Participate in system design consulting, platform management, and capacity planning
  • Improve reliability, quality, and time-to-market of our software solutions, including software development
  • Partner closely with engineering and development teams to enhance product stability, observability, and manageability through best practices in reliability engineering.
  • Partner closely with DevOps/Operations, drive automation initiatives, promote Infrastructure as Code (IaC), and streamline deployment processes to improve operational efficiency and scalability.
Who you are and what you’ll need for this position:
  • 5+ years of experience in software development (ideally working with and as a .NET developer)
  • Strong understanding of SDLC, microservice architecture
  • Observability - NewRelic, Elastic, Grafana, PagerDuty, OTEL
  • Knowledge Kubernetes clusters in production setting, AWS, IOC
  • Knowledge of CI-CD tooling Jenkins, Gitlab, GitHub, ArgoCD or similar
  • 5+ years relational databases (mysql, postgres) as a plus
